Aftermath of the flooding at Sugar Sands Campground in Vancleave

Days after the severe flooding which forced residents to evacuate at Sugar Sands Campground in Vancleave, water levels have finally reduced allowing those impacted to return to their RV’s. On Saturday the campgrounds were engulfed by floods brought on from Fridays night’s storms, forcing residents to leave their RV’s as well as the rest of their belongings behind. Relief efforts…

Man dies after driving off fishing pier in Biloxi

A Florida man died Sunday night after driving off the fishing pier off Howard Avenue in Biloxi. Harrison County Coroner Brian Switzer said 67-year-old Paul Costello of Milton, Florida, was pronounced dead at the scene after first responders pulled the vehicle he was driving out of the Back Bay shortly after 1 a.m. WXXV News 25’s Jordyn Lassiter went to the pier…

Ocean Spring High’s Blue-Grey Pride Band visits Windsor Castle

The Blue Grey Pride has officially made it across the pond! These are pictures of the Pride visiting Windsor Castle. The castle is home of the Royal family with burials ranging back to King Edward IV from the 1400s. The band is set to perform during the London New Year’s Day Parade. Vancleave resident speaks on dangerous flooding from storms

Storms over the weekend brought on flooding in various parts of South Mississippi, including Vancleave. On Saturday part of Barge Landing Rd was submerged underwater as Bluff Creek overflowed from Friday night’s weather. That flooding left some residents unable to access their homes along the river. Morning Reporter Everett Ganier Jr. LIVE in Gulfport informing you about Christmas Tree drop-offs

Mississippi Power, in collaboration with Harrison County, is offering a Christmas Tree Recycling program from December 26, 2024 to January 12, 2025. Residents can drop off their live Christmas Trees at several designated locations across Harrison County. WXXV News 25’s Everett Ganier, Jr. was live in Gulfport giving you the details.
